What is Testing Shock Resistance of E-Scooter Wheels and Tires?

Testing shock resistance involves subjecting e-scooter wheels and tires to various types of impacts, such as drops, bumps, or sudden stops. Our expert technicians use specialized equipment to replicate real-world scenarios, simulating the stresses that these components may face during normal operation.

The goal of shock resistance testing is to evaluate the performance of wheels and tires under different conditions, including

  • Drop tests Simulating falls from a specified height to assess damage and impact on safety features.

  • Impact tests Evaluating the response of wheels and tires to sudden stops or collisions.

  • Vibration tests Assessing the effects of repetitive vibrations on wheel and tire integrity.
